What you need to know about Bukit Baru
A residential suburb in Melaka with a mix of low-rise housing and local commerce, Bukit Baru has a quiet, family-oriented character that shapes steady demand for homes from people working in the city and nearby service sectors. Bukit Baru offers typical Malaysian property types—rumah teres (terraced houses), some semi-detached units (semi-D), and low- to mid-rise apartments or flats—so buyers and renters can choose between landed options and more affordable flats. Road connections make commuting by car or ride-hailing the most practical option, while basic amenities such as neighbourhood shops, schools and clinics are within reach for daily needs. Rental interest tends to come from local families and workers, and the market has shown modest, steady interest in line with broader Melaka trends rather than rapid change.
